3M Professional Grade Rubberized Undercoating is an easy to use black protective coating that does not run when applied, provides anti corrosive protection, sound deadening and insulation to cars, trucks and recreational vehicles.

Product Features:
  • Can be used on cars, trucks and recreational vehicles
  • Black protective coating helps prevent damage from corrosion
  • Sound-deadening properties help reduce road noise
  • No-run formula for clean application

Application Method:Automotive Undercoating
Color:Black
Compatible Surfaces:Under surface of vehicles
Container/Package Size:16 oz
Container/Package Type:Aerosol Can
Rubberized:Yes
Shelf Life:24 months
Sound Deadening:Yes

                    • Q:

                      I am having my chimney repointed. The contractor sprayed this product on my chimney cap when the temperature was ten degrees out. Everything i read says a rubberized undercoating should not be applied unless it is 50 degrees or above. Should i have them re apply this product?
                      Asked on 2/2/2013 by C J from Jeannette PA

                      1 answer

                      • CUSTOMER CARE

                        A:

                        With reference to your inquiry on the 3M Professional Grade Rubberized Undercoating (16 oz.) - Part No. 03584, temperatures must remain between 50 and 90 degrees Fahrenheit for the coating to cure properly. If it was applied in a lower temperature than 50 degrees, a reapplication is required to repair.
